RPM Activated Switch install for GSR secondaries
I got a MSD RPM activated switch with a 5800RPM pill so I can hook them up to the secondary butterflies on my GSR manifold and I'm trying to get the wiring down. I got the following hooked up:
Red: power
Black: ground
Gray: ground for butterflies
White: DONT KNOW WHERE THIS GOES, but it's for the RPM input
Yellow: not used, correct?
Basically, I tried hooking the white wire to the same blue wire that my shift light is hooked to, and it didnt work, PLUS my tach wouldnt move either. So where do I hook up the RPM wire too? What is the wire color in the engine bay? If need be, I can post pictures. Thanks.

Its made to be used in conjunction with an MSD igniton box, or an MSD signal amplifier, the white wire plugs into them. The switch you have draws the all the voltage for itself and doesnt share. The MSD boxes have an output for them the signal amplifier just makes the signal stronger with no ignition system gains.
